Tulsa 2012 Final Score: Golden Hurricanes Hold On For 27-26 Win

<p>The Tulsa Golden Hurricanes scored ten unanswered points in the second half Saturday night, beating Fresno State 27-26 at Chapman Stadium in Tulsa, OK.</p>
<p>The Hurricanes trailed the Bulldogs 20-7 at the end of the first quarter before scoring ten points in the second quarter to take a 20-17 deficit into halftime.</p>
<p>Fresno State would score just under three minutes into the second half, when Cody Green threw his second pick-six of the game. Tulsa would respond, however, with a <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/161353/daniel-schwarz">Daniel Schwarz</a> field goal and <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/79659/trey-watts">Trey Watts</a> touchdown pass to take the lead late in the third quarter.</p>
<p>The key to the win would ultimately happen on the extra point attempt following a <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/86044/tristan-okpalaugo">Tristan Okpalaugo</a> interception return, as <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/136750/quentin-breshears">Quentin Breshears</a>' extra point try was blocked.</p>
<p>The Hurricanes used strong defense in the second half to get the win, taking advantage of several short fields in the third quarter to take the lead and then holding strong through the fourth quarter.</p>
<p>Tulsa quarterback Cody Green was 13-of-37 for 202 yards, one touchdown and three interceptions on the night, while Alex Singleton led the Tulsa rushing attack with 56 yards on 18 carries.</p>
<p>Tulsa (3-1) heads to UAB for next week's game, with kickoff set for 2 p.m. CT.</p>

<p>The <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/teams/tulsa-golden-hurricane">Tulsa Golden Hurricane</a> trail the <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/teams/fresno-st-bulldogs">Fresno State Bulldogs</a>, 20-17, at halftime, with Tulsa scoring 10 points in the second quarter to close up a big first quarter deficit.</p>
<p>Fresno State jumped out to a 20-7 lead in the first quarter, thanks to a pair of lengthy touchdown drives and a interception return for a touchdown by <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/86024/patrick-su-a" class="sbn-auto-link">Patrick Su'a</a>.</p>
<p>Tulsa has had trouble finding balance on offense, with quarterback <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/76902/cody-green">Cody Green</a> 6-of-17 for 128 yards, one touchdown and two interceptions in the first half. The Hurricanes are averaging under three yards per carry as well, managing just 58 yards on 20 carries as a team.</p>
<p>The Hurricane were able to rebound, however, with 10 points in the second quarter to close to within 20-17 heading into the half. Green capped off a 48-yard drive with a 31-yard touchdown pass to <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/135511/keyarris-garrett" class="sbn-auto-link">Keyarris Garrett</a>, with <a class="sbn-auto-link" href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/161353/daniel-schwarz">Daniel Schwarz</a> nailing a 24-yard field goal with 4:46 remaining in the second quarter.</p>

<p>Game time, TV, odds and more for Saturday's Mountain West matchup between Fresno State and Tulsa. </p> <p>The Mountain West Conference has a chance to put on one of the most exciting offensive matchups in this young college football season when Fresno State visits Tulsa on Saturday evening. The Bulldogs are coming off a 69-14 shellacking of Colorado; the Golden Hurricane has outscored Tulane and Nicholls State 111-26 in its first two wins of 2012.</p>
<p>Both teams are 2-1 in nonconference play. Fresno also beat Weber State and lost to Oregon 42-25. Tulsa lost to Iowa State in Ames in its opener.</p>
<p>The Golden Hurricane is averaging 285.7 yards a game on the ground. They hope to take advantage of a Bulldogs defense that gave up 366 rushing yards to Oregon.</p>
<p>The Bulldogs' Phillip Thomas had three interceptions, including two pick-sixes, in the win against Colorado last Saturday, and was named the Jim Thorpe Defensive Back of the Week for his efforts. Thomas and his mates in the defensive backfield <a href="http://www.fresnobee.com/2012/09/20/2999208/fresno-state-prepares-for-tall.html" target="_blank">need to stop Tulsa's tall receiving corps</a>, who include <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/135511/keyarris-garrett" class="sbn-auto-link">Keyarris Garrett</a> (6'4), <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/116353/thomas-roberson" class="sbn-auto-link">Thomas Roberson</a> (6'3) and <a href="http://www.sbnation.com/ncaa-football/players/79656/jordan-james" class="sbn-auto-link">Jordan James</a> (6'2).</p>
<p>Game Time: 8 p.m. ET</p>
<p>TV: CBS Sports Network</p>
<p>Odds<b>: </b>Tulsa is a <a href="http://www.oddsshark.com/ncaaf/fresno-state-tulsa-odds-september-22-2012" target="_blank">5 1/2 point favorite on most books</a>.</p>
